Successful applications for SBRI funding through RAPID

A proportion of RAPID funding (£500K) has been made available for Small and Medium Sized Enterprises (SMEs) as part of NERC's Small Business Research Initiative (SBRI). The SBRI aims to stimulate innovation in the economy by encouraging more high-tech small firms to start up or to develop new research capacities.

Four projects are being funded by RAPID under SBRI (for details see below) and the funds available for SBRI have now been fully allocated. Therefore no further SBRI funding will be available under RAPID.
